WJEC Criminology Unit 2
What is deviance? - ANS-Deviance is behaviour which goes against socially acceptable codes
of conduct

What are the 3 types of deviance? - ANS-Behaviour which is unusual, but good
Behaviour which is unusual, and eccentric
Behaviour which is unusual, but bad

What social characteristics are needed for something to be classed as relative deviant concept -
ANS-Age & Gender

Formal sanctions against deviance - ANS-Criminal Behavioural Order
Fines
Disciplinary action

Informal sanctions against deviance - ANS-Judgement
Stigmatisation
Margininalisation
Ridicule

What is the legal definition of crime? - ANS-An act which breaks the law and is subject to official
punishment

What are the two elements of crime? - ANS-actus reus
mens rea

What does actus reus mean? - ANS-guilty act

What does men's rea mean - ANS-guilty mind

What is a crime in terms of actus reus and men's rea? - ANS-An act which breaks the law with
bad intentions, it's done deliberately

Exceptions to crime in terms of actus reus and men's rea - ANS-Strict liability; self defence &
manslaughter

Without both actus reus and men's rea the offender receives... - ANS-A lesser sentence

What are the 3 types of offences? - ANS-Summary Offence - Tried by a
magistrate.(eg.shoplifting)
Hybrid Offence - Either magistrate or crown court. (eg. burglary)
Indictable Offence - Tried by crown court only. (eg. murder or rape)

, How long do crimes for armed offences be sentenced to? - ANS-25 years minimum

Crimes can be classified in terms of the nature of the crime... - ANS-Violence against the person
(GBH)
Sexual offences (Rape)
Offences against property (burglary)
Fraud & Forgery (identity theft)
Criminal Damage (Vandalism)
Drug offences (possession & distribution)
Public order offences (Anti- Social Behaviour)

What is the social definition of crime? - ANS-Behavior that offends the social code of a
community

Give an example of social crime - ANS-Forced Marriages at 14 in Bangladesh

What are the three aspects of social crime? - ANS-Differing views: Differing views on what acts
are defined as illegal (speeding & vagrancy)

Law enforcement: Not all crimes are enforced by police as they don't personally believe in
enforcing it (smoking cannabis)

Law making : Politicians decide what constitutes a crime and the public may not always agree
(Dangerous dog act)

Court sanctions for criminals - ANS-Custodial sentences (prisons & institutions)
Discharge (guilty, but not convicted, minor)
Community sentences and fines

Police sanctions for criminals - ANS-Penalty notices (driving, pay money)
Cautions (evidence of bad character)
Conditional Caution (must abide rules to avoid persecution)

Acts which are criminal, but not deviant - ANS-Illegal downloading
Speeding
Homelessness

Acts which are deviant, but not criminal - ANS-Queue jumping
Speaking loudly in a doctors waiting room

What is meant by the social construction of criminality? - ANS-Crimes are not an objective
reality, they are subjective and based on personal views and social factors whether or not
something is regarded as a crime.
